]> git.nothing2do.fr Git - get-hack-src.git/commitdiff
Added auto install and uninstall of entities and machines during install-package...
authorallfro <ndouba@gmail.com>
Sat, 8 Dec 2012 04:11:47 +0000 (23:11 -0500)
committerallfro <ndouba@gmail.com>
Sat, 8 Dec 2012 04:11:47 +0000 (23:11 -0500)
src/canari/commands/create_package.py
src/canari/resources/template/MANIFEST.plate [new file with mode: 0644]

index 8b2c9f752373d6e9d971f7bec92f15f6755f8284..a4ff4f06ed29cfe0788a89a3ba7fd1afb5536db7 100644 (file)
@@ -35,6 +35,7 @@ def write_setup(package_name, values):
     write_template(sep.join([package_name, '.canari']), read_template('_canari', values))
     write_template(sep.join([package_name, 'setup.py']), read_template('setup', values))
     write_template(sep.join([package_name, 'README.md']), read_template('README', values))
+    write_template(sep.join([package_name, 'MANIFEST.in']), read_template('MANIFEST', values))
 
 
 def write_root(base, init):
diff --git a/src/canari/resources/template/MANIFEST.plate b/src/canari/resources/template/MANIFEST.plate
new file mode 100644 (file)
index 0000000..6744099
--- /dev/null
@@ -0,0 +1,3 @@
+include *.md
+recursive-include src *.py *.conf *.gif *.png *.mtz *.machine
+recursive-include maltego *.mtz